Overview of Formwork Steel Props in Construction Industry

In recent years, the construction industry has seen a significant rise in the use of formwork steel props. These props provide crucial support during the construction process. Their design allows for easy adjustments to height and load capacity. This flexibility makes them popular among contractors. Moreover, they are generally more durable than conventional wooden props. However, some users do report challenges with alignment and stability.

Latest Trends in Formwork Steel Prop Design and Materials

The 139th Canton Fair presented intriguing advancements in formwork steel prop design. Manufacturers showcased innovative designs that emphasize structural integrity and lightweight materials. New trends focus on using high-strength steel and composite materials to enhance durability while reducing weight. This shift promotes efficiency on job sites.

Sustainability is also a critical consideration. Some designs incorporate recycled materials, aiming to minimize environmental impact. This focus on green solutions resonates with industry demands for more responsible construction practices. However, challenges still exist.
